Salome HOME
Add "Deflection 2D" quality control
[modules/smesh.git] / src / SMDS / SMDS_SetIterator.hxx
index e0b3c8b0888938ca1eafaed263dc8bbb4b69e437..3402cbf6a9e783ffd9d158e3421c8822550b0b74 100644 (file)
@@ -51,6 +51,11 @@ namespace SMDS {
     static VALUE value(VALUE_SET_ITERATOR it) { return (VALUE) it->second; }
   };
 
+  template<typename VALUE,typename VALUE_SET_ITERATOR>
+  struct PointerAccessor {
+    static VALUE value(VALUE_SET_ITERATOR it) { return (VALUE) &(*it); }
+  };
+
   ///////////////////////////////////////////////////////////////////////////////
   /// Filters of value pointed by iterator
   ///////////////////////////////////////////////////////////////////////////////